案例从小陈的一次体验开始。某日他在TP钱包发现一个曾授权的支付应用仍能动用代币,担心重复扣款,于是启动撤销流程。首先,必须识别被授权的合约地址与对应代币的allowance——这是在链上以公钥对应的地址记录的授权额度;撤销并不直接更换公钥,签名权限仍由私钥控制,若私钥泄露需做密钥迁移或社交恢复。专业研究建议先用链上扫描工具(如Etherscan、Revoke.cash或TP内置审计)查看交易明细与事件日志,确认授权交易哈希、区块高度、nonce与已消耗gas,判断是否存在周期性或定时拉取款项的

合约接口。操作层面,TP钱包通常提供“管理授权”入口,选择撤销将发起一笔发送到token合约的交易(常见做法是将allowance设为0或调用revoke),此过程涉及签名、支付矿工费并等待链上确认。为保证便捷支付不中断又能降低风险,可以采用分级授权:为小额支付设置单次或限额授权,或使用时间锁、白名单及多签智能合约钱包;新兴技术如账号抽象(ERC-4337)、智能合约钱包与Gas付费中继能把权限管理与支付体验解耦,支持更细粒度的高级风险控制。深入分析流程应包括:一、枚举所有授权目标并抓取交易明细;二、用合约ABI反

查函数调用与允许范围;三、在测试网络模拟撤销以估算gas与失败风险;四、提交撤销交易并通过事件日志验证效果;五、建立监控策略,异常调用即时告警。结论是:取消授权既是技术操作也是策略决策,既要熟练掌握链上交易与公钥签名机制的细节,也要借助审计工具、智能合约钱包与先进权限模型,把便捷支付的体验与高级风险控制结合起来,才能在智能金融生态中既安全又高效地管理每一次授权与撤销。
作者:周以辰发布时间:2026-01-31 19:07:58
评论